GYEON Q2M Tar is a highly effective citrus-based product designed to remove bonded adhesives from paintwork.
Vehicles typically accumulate large amounts of tar and asphalt contamination during everyday use. The greater the horsepower and the more aggressively a car is driven, the larger the issue becomes. This is where Q²M Tar REDEFINED provides an excellent solution. With its new low-VOC formula, it accelerates the decontamination process and reduces the time-consuming steps usually required, such as claying. Therefore, it is a healthier product for the user. By effectively dissolving most contaminants, it allows you to achieve a smooth finish in record time.
On soft or medium paints, even the use of mild clay may cause marring. Since most contamination can be dissolved through the combined use of GYEON Q²M Tar and GYEON Q²M Iron, this product is also highly beneficial for maintaining cars that have undergone paint correction in the past. It enables you to remove pollution without leaving blemishes or scratches that would otherwise require polishing and does not affect the coating underneath.
Unlike most tar removers, GYEON Q2M Tar does not harm any exterior surfaces and is safe for bodywork. It can be used on paint, glass, and plastic trim, both painted and unpainted. Being pH neutral, it can also be used to remove tar spots from bare polished lips.
GYEON Q2M Tar not only removes tar or asphalt but also organic contamination such as sap or environmental pollution. It also helps dissolve resin.
GYEON Q2M Tar can also be with our chemical-resistant GYEON Q2M Clay, similar to GYEON Q2M Iron. Due to its slickness it provides sufficient lubrication when claying, which overall shortens the entire preparation process for heavily contaminated vehicles before any paint correction.
